What are antihistamines.?
Antihistamines are medicines that help stop allergy symptoms such as itchy eyes, sneezing and a runny nose. Sometimes, itchy rashes (especially hives) may also be helped by an antihistamine.Health Question & Answer

Go to the emergency room or urgent care facility. In the most severe case, an allergic reaction can turn anaphylactic quickly. There is no way to tell via the internet if your reaction will get worse or not. The hives will require medical intervention anyway, so it is better for you to just go in to have this properly diagnosed and treated accordingly. Good luck!Health Question & Answer
